Javascript 비동기 함수들

채무·2024년 1월 31일

Web

목록 보기
6/11


setTimeout 함수

특정 함수의 실행을 원하는 시간만큼 뒤로 미루기 위해 사용하는 함수이다

console.log('a');
setTimeout(() => { console.log('b'); }, 2000);
console.log('c');
  • 위의 코드에서 setTimeout 함수는 콜백함수를 2초(2000ms)만큼 뒤로 미뤄서 실행한다

setInterval 함수

특정 콜백을 일정한 시간 간격으로 실행하도록 등록하는 함수이다

console.log('a');
setInterval(() => { console.log('b'); }, 2000);
console.log('c');
  • 위의 코드에서 setInterval 함수는 2초 간격으로 콜백함수를 실행한다

addEventListener 메소드

addEventListener 메소드는 특정 이벤트가 발생했을 때 실행할 콜백을 등록하는 DOM 객체의 메소드이다

btn.addEventListener('click', function (e) { // 해당 이벤트 객체가 파라미터 e로 넘어옵니다.
  console.log('Hello Codeit!');
});
profile
개발한 기발자

0개의 댓글